About A. D. May

A. D. May is a scholar working on Spectroscopy,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ics, Atmospheric Science, Electrical and Electronic Engineering and Global and Planetary Change, having authored 126 papers that have together received 2.5k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Spectroscopy and Laser Applications (79 papers), Atmospheric Ozone and Climate (42 papers), Atmospheric and Environmental Gas Dynamics (25 papers), Quantum, superfluid, helium dynamics (19 papers), Spectroscopy and Quantum Chemical Studies (18 papers), Laser Design and Applications (16 papers), Advanced Fiber Laser Technologies (15 papers) and Advanced Chemical Physics Studies (10 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Spectroscopy (1.7k citations), Atmospheric Science (1.1k citations),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ics (1.1k citations), Global and Planetary Change (558 citations) and Acoustics and Ultrasonics (13 citations). A. D. May has collaborated with scholars based in Canada, France and United States. Frequent co-authors include J. C. Stryland, P. M. Sinclair, P. Duggan, J. R. Drummond, G. Stéphan, H. L. Welsh, R. Berman, James R. Drummond, R. Ciuryło and George Varghese.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of Molecular Spectroscopy, Physical Review A, The Journal of Chemical Physics, Journal of the Optical Society of America B and Canadian Journal of Physics.
